What is the average price of a house in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ire?
The average price for a house in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is £800k, costing on average £988 per sqft.
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£439k for a two-bedroom, £560k for a three-bedroom, £827k for a four-bedroom, and £1.20m for a five-bedroom.
What share of houses in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ire feature gardens and parking?
In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ire, 95% of houses have a garden and 91% include parking.
What is the breakdown of property types in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ire?
The housing mix in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is 35% detached, 35% semi-detached, 21% terraced, and 9% other.
What is the most expensive area in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ire to buy a home?
The most expensive area to buy a house in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is SL0, where the average property is £880k. The second and third most expensive areas are SL2 with an average price of £847k and SL3 with an average price of £673k .

What is the average price of a flat in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ire?
The average price for a flat in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is £297k, costing on average £1k per sqft.
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£214k for a one-bedroom, £330k for a two-bedroom, £411k for a three-bedroom, and £285k for a four-bedroom.
What share of flats in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ire feature balconies and parking?
In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ire, 23% of flats have a balcony and 87% include parking.
What is the breakdown of lease types in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ire?
The leasing mix in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is 100% leasehold and 0% freehold.
What is the most expensive area in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ire to buy a flat?
The most expensive area to buy a flat in Stoke Poges and Wexham, Buckinghamshire is SL0, where the average property is £381k. The second and third most expensive areas are SL2 with an average price of £265k and SL3 with an average price of £247k .
